The reefer container market is led by a mix of container manufacturers, refrigeration technology providers, and global shipping operators that are strengthening temperature-controlled logistics infrastructure. Key manufacturers such as CIMC, Maersk Container Industry, and Daikin Industries are advancing energy-efficient refrigeration units and smart container technologies to ensure precise temperature control and real-time monitoring. At the same time, companies like Singamas Container Holdings Ltd and CXIC Group are expanding production capacity to meet rising global trade demand. Industry insights indicate that more than 70% of reefer container usage is driven by food and agricultural products, particularly perishable goods such as fruits, vegetables, meat, and seafood.
On the logistics side, major shipping lines including MSC Mediterranean Shipping Company, CMA CGM Group, and Ocean Network Express are investing heavily in expanding their refrigerated fleets and cold chain networks. Meanwhile, A.P. Moller and ZIM Integrated Shipping Services are focusing on digital tracking systems and integrated logistics solutions to improve cargo visibility and reduce spoilage risks. With the rapid growth of pharmaceutical shipments and global food trade, nearly 20 - 25% of reefer demand is now linked to healthcare and high-value cargo, pushing companies to prioritize reliability, regulatory compliance, and advanced cold chain capabilities.
Recent Developments:
- In October 2025, DP World has revealed the primary focused reefer rail freight service from Thimmapur, Hyderabad to Nhava Sheva (JNPA) in partnership with Ocean Network Express (ONE). The service has officially marked an initial refrigerated rail movement from DP World’s Thimmapur Inland Container Depot (ICD) to an Nhava Sheva, that serves a personalized logistics solution for the pharmaceutical exporters in region.
- In March 2026, Container Corporation of India has initiated its first-ever dedicated Reefer Express train service from locality of ICD JRY Kanpur to an Mundra Port-which is an achievement that opens an link for temperature controlled rail corridor between one of North India’s most crucial inland logistics locations.
- In April 2025, SeaCube Containers ,who is an worldwide topper in terms of refrigerated intermodal leasing ,has revealed SeaCube Cold Solutions, which is an movable cold storage service crafted to align with developing urge for temperature-controlled storage in the food sector.
- In March 2026, Rwanda has disclosed an latest export beginning whose goal is to develop market permission for agricultural producers, that concentrates on direct air cargo shipments for vegetables and fruits to Central and West Africa. Such program has started by the National Agricultural Export Development Board (NAEB) and aims quicker and more expected regional distribution.
- In August 2025, Samskip , is a worldwide logistics organization which delivers transport services with the help of sea, land, air and rail ,who has revealed the launch of latest short sea shipping route which connects the Moroccan cities of Casablanca and Agadir straight with Netherlands and United Kingdom.
